About this House

Offered for the first time ever, this lovingly maintained one-family owned home is a rare opportunity in the heart of South Windham. Situated on a beautifully landscaped lot featuring mature lilac trees, established perennial gardens, and plenty of outdoor space to enjoy, this property combines timeless charm with an unbeatable location.

Inside, you'll find spacious bedrooms, inviting living areas, and a cozy den centered around a fireplace--perfect for relaxing on a quiet Maine evening. The home's thoughtful layout offers comfortable everyday living while providing the opportunity to update and personalize to suit your style.

Outdoor enthusiasts will appreciate being directly across the street from the Mountain Division Trail and Sebago to Sea Trail, offering miles of year-round recreation. The property is also just steps from the scenic Presumpscot River, a treasured local resource known for its natural beauty and recreational opportunities.

Located in the growing South Windham Village area, this home enjoys convenient access to local favorites including the nearby Red City Ale House, shopping, schools, and everyday amenities. Combining a sought-after location, beautiful landscaping, one-family ownership, and endless potential, this is a special opportunity to own a home that has been cherished for generations and is ready for its next chapter.
41 Main Street, Windham, ME 04062 is a 4 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,764 sqft single-family home built in 1930. It last sold for $405,000 on Jul 30, 2026 (2% above the $399,000 asking price). It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$405,100, with a rent estimate of $2,823/month.

  • Julie L. D.
    "I live two streets from Carmichael and love living so close to the lakes and less than twenty minutes to Portland! The schools are within a 5-7 minute drive and shopping is less than three miles down the road. You can avoid the traffic by taking the backroads, that lead into outer Washington Ave or travel down the road to enter the Maine Turnpike just down the street in Gray. I love listening to the loons on the lake, early Spring into the Fall, and it is always fun to watch the fireworks show on the lake July 4th, put on by neighbors all around the lake! With the snowmobile trails so close by, I can hop on my sled, ice fishing, ice skate, or boat all outside my front door! This is a great area to retire, or raise a family"
